Is Gumtree.com.au Any Good To Sell My Car

Following last week’s thoughts on CarSales.com.au, this week I look at the question – Is Gumtree.com.au any good to sell my car?

Gumtree is certainly not for every car.

Nor for every person wanting to sell a car.

There is a lot of riff-raff on there.

When comparing to CarSales.com.au, you might say this is the poor side of town.

Yes it is true.

To place your ad on Gumtree, the advertising is free.

But the catch is as other cars are added to the same category, yours is pushed down the list.

You need to spend $2.99 to “bump up” the ad to bring it back up to the top.

In our experience, Gumtree attracts only buyers who are looking for very CHEAP.

Don’t even bother on here with a car worth more than $1,500.

Even then, expect to get a lot of people replying to your ad via text and email wanting discounts.

We’ve found Gumtree.com.au to also have more fraudulent activity.

What I mean by this is people wanting to pay via Western Union or PyPal but interestingly ask for your details first.

We just ignore these requests. You should too.
